Transaction 26451fedd173e915a73970ae282c3e1942ddb0ffea9675d5989ebdd5e1dfcdc6
1 Input
1 Output
-
26451fedd173e915a73970ae282c3e1942ddb0ffea9675d5989ebdd5e1dfcdc6:0
- value
- 615891
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 69e2d93f34c2b7f62c22cab0db5ab276f4cb9c8a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AeshrvLKnPKF1ripHWT8rCXswDEJqobvW